Do you have any habits you incorporate into your life to keep you healthy? Some people take vitamins. Some are on an exercise regiment. Still other folks may follow a strict diet. I am a firm advocate of the habit of faithful church attendance. People neglect church attendance for all kinds of reasons. “It’s my only day off.” “My team has a game that day.” “All they talk about is money.” “They make me feel guilty.” Perhaps you have thought of or heard one of these rationales. Here are some compelling reasons to incorporate faithful church attendance into your life.

IT IS A BIBLICAL REQUIREMENT. Hebrews 10:25 says, Let us not give up meeting together, as some are in the habit of doing.

IT FOLLOWS JESUS’ EXAMPLE. If anyone could be justified in not going to religious services, it would be Jesus. Yet we see in Jesus’ life a clear pattern of going to the place of public worship: He went to Nazareth, where He had been brought up, and on the Sabbath day He went into the synagogue, as was His custom. Luke 4:16

IT PROVIDES SPIRITUAL ENCOURAGEMENT. The work of the early church is summarized in Acts 2:42: They devoted themselves to the apostles' teaching and to the fellowship, to the breaking of bread and to prayer. Notice that these are all community activities.

IT IS GOD’S DESIGN. 1 Corinthians 12 and 14 show the importance of each Christian using his or her spiritual gifts to build up the body of Christ, that is, the church. How can this occur if you are not going to where the body is gathered?

IT CONTRIBUTES TO OVERALL HEALTH. An article in the November 10, 2003 issue of Newsweek magazine quoted the results of a study performed by Rush University Medical Center in Chicago. This study found that people who regularly attend church services have a 25 percent reduction in mortality than people who are not churchgoers. In other words, church attendees live longer than non-attendees.

We can always conjure up excuses for lax church attendance. But these pale in comparison to the very good reasons to be faithful to God’s church. Remember, whenever God tells us to do something, it is for our own good.
